I NEED YOUR HELP GUYS
I think my ps3 just kicked the bucket. I was playing U3 and it just shut off on my. and the red light just kept blinking, i tried to turn it on, and i saw a yellow light for a second, then it would just turn off again. I turned it off by hitting the power switch in the back, and when i turned it back on i help the eject button, and was able to get my copy of u3 out of it. But when i try to turn it on now, it just shows the green light, then the yellow light, then it just blinks red. If someone can let me know what i can try to do to repair it that would be appreciated

^ i looked it up. its basically what plagued the xbox 360 with the red ring of death. ps3 version is called the yellow light of death. basically the heat sync stopped doing its job, so now there's an issue with the solder on the board. I would call sony and pay for a fix, but i have a Japanese ps3, so they won't touch it, they would want me to send it away to japan for repair. so I;m going to attempt to fix it myself tomorrow. i was able to fix it. I reflowed the solder using a heat gun, and applied new thermal paste to the cpu and gpu. I suggest you guys with the old models look up how to do it. It seems like its only a matter of time until the thermal paste dries up and the heat sync stops doing its job
